Evaluation of Boride Layer Growth on Carbon Steel Surfaces
The kinetics of growth of the boride layer in the boronizing of carbon steels from EKABOR 3 powder is studied. Relations between the thickness of the boride layer and the parameters of the process, i.e., the temperature and the duration of the boronizing operation, and the composition of the saturated steel are derived. The morphology and the types of the borides are determined by the methods of light microscopy and x-ray diffraction. The parameters of the Arrhenius equation for the kinetics of boronizing are computed. The contour diagram obtained for the variation of the thickness of boride layer makes it possible to determine the size of the layer from data on the parameters of the process.
